Система сравнительного анализа социально-экономических процессов

 

Полезная модель относится к области социально-экономического анализа и может быть использована как специализированное вычислительное средство при решении как сугубо научных, так и прикладных задач. Технический результат заключается в обеспечении возможности сравнения исследуемого процесса с уже известными похожей природы. Для достижения технического результата система содержит подсистему выделение репрезентативной части исследуемого процесса, подсистему хранения выборки исследуемого процесса, подсистему масштабирования исследуемого процесса, подсистему нормирования исследуемого процесса, подсистему сравнения, а также банк априорных данных, подсистему масштабирования эталонного процесса и подсистему нормирования эталонного процесса.

Полезная модель относится к области социально-экономического анализа и может быть использована как специализированное вычислительное средство при решении как сугубо научных, так и прикладных задач.

Известны различные специализированные средства, повышающие эффективность прикладных исследований, в том числе и социально-экономических. В качестве прототипа по результатам анализа уровня техники выбрана система учета и контроля, предназначенная для исследования динамики процессов различного характера, включая социально-экономического [Пат. RU 2174256, G 06 F 17/60, G 07 F 19/00, Опубл. 27.09.2001]. Основу системы составляют подсистема обработки и блок памяти. Несмотря на относительно широкие возможности, система не ориентирована на проведение сравнительного анализа процессов, что следует отнести к ее недостатку.

Технический результат, достигаемый при использовании заявленной полезной модели, заключается в обеспечении возможности сравнения исследуемого социально-экономического процесса с уже известными процессами похожей природы.

Для достижения технического результата система сравнительного анализа социально-экономических процессов, согласно полезной модели, содержит подсистему выделения репрезентативной части исследуемого процесса, подсистему хранения выборки исследуемого процесса, подсистему масштабирования во времени исследуемого процесса, подсистему нормирования исследуемого процесса, банк априорных данных, подсистему выбора класса процессов, подсистему масштабирования во времени эталонного процесса, подсистему нормирования эталонного процесса и подсистему сравнения исследуемого и эталонного процессов, подсистема выделения репрезентативной части предназначена для получения исходных данных и формирования выборки содержащей информацию о характерных свойствах исследуемого процесса, выход подсистемы выделения репрезентативной части соединен со входом подсистемы хранения выборки исследуемого процесса, выход которой соединен со входом подсистемы масштабирования во времени исследуемого процесса, выход которой соединен со входом подсистемы нормирования исследуемого процесса, управляющий вход банка априорных данных соединен с выходом подсистемы выбора класса процессов, выход банка априорных данных соединен со входом подсистемы масштабирования во времени эталонного процесса, выход которой соединен со входом

подсистемы нормирования эталонного процесса, выход которой соединен с первым входом подсистемы сравнения, второй вход которой соединен с выходом подсистемы нормирования исследуемого процесса.

Для достижения технического результата подсистема сравнения исследуемого и эталонного процессов может быть выполнена на основе вычислителя максимальной величины абсолютного уклонения сравниваемых величин.

Для достижения технического результата подсистема сравнения исследуемого и эталонного процессов может быть выполнена на основе вычислителя интеграла от модуля разности сравниваемых величин.

Для достижения технического результата подсистема сравнения исследуемого и эталонного процессов может быть выполнена на основе вычислителя среднего значения модуля разности сравниваемых величин.

Для достижения технического результата подсистема сравнения исследуемого и эталонного процессов может быть выполнена на основе вычислителя среднеквадратического значения разности сравниваемых величин.

Для достижения технического результата подсистема сравнения исследуемого и эталонного процессов может быть выполнена на основе вычислителя корреляционного интеграла.

Сущность полезной модели поясняется графическим материалом.

На фиг.1 показана функциональная схема системы сравнительного анализа социально-экономических процессов; на фиг.2 показана функциональная схема подсистемы нормирования; на фиг.3 показана функциональная схема одного из вариантов исполнения подсистемы сравнения.

Функциональная схема по фиг.1 содержит подсистему 1 выделения репрезентативной части исследуемого процесса, подсистему 2 хранения выборки исследуемого процесса, банк 3 априорных данных, подсистему 4 выбора класса процессов, подсистему 5 масштабирования во времени исследуемого процесса, подсистему 6 масштабирования во времени эталонного процесса, подсистему 7 нормирования исследуемого процесса, подсистему 8 нормирования эталонного процесса, подсистему 9 сравнения исследуемого и эталонного процессов. Выход подсистемы 1 выделения репрезентативной части соединен со входом подсистемы 2 хранения выборки, выход которой соединен со входом подсистемы 5 масштабирования, выход которой соединен со входом подсистемы 7 нормирования, выход которой соединен с одним из входов подсистемы 9 сравнения, второй вход которой соединен с выходом подсистемы 8 нормирования, вход которой соединен с выходом подсистемы 6 масштабирования, вход которой соединен с выходом банка 3 априорных данных,

управляющий вход которого соединен с выходом подсистемы 4 выбора класса процессов, информационный вход банка 3 служит входом для приема накапливаемой информации об известных процессах, входом исследуемого процесса в системе служит вход подсистемы 1, а выходом системы является выход подсистемы 9, служащий выходом результата сравнения.

Функциональная схема по фиг.2 содержит блок 10 хранения опорного значения и блок 11 деления, выход которого служит выходом подсистемы нормированиия, входом которой является первый вход блока 11 деления, второй вход которого соединен с выходом блока 10 хранения опорного значения.

Функциональная схема по фиг.3 содержит блок 12 вычитания, блок 13 выделения модуля и блок 14 усреднения, выход которого является выходом подсистемы сравнения, входами которой являются входы блока 12 вычитания, выход которого соединен со входом блока 13 выделения модуля, выход которого соединен со входом блока 14 усреднения.

Система сравнительного анализа социально-экономических процессов функционирует следующим образом (фиг.1).

Исследуемый процесс, представленный в общем виде как одна из реализации (t) случайной функции из некоторого ансамбля, поступает для первоначальной обработки в подсистему 1, где происходит выделение наиболее значимой части процесса, определяющей характер его поведения и свободной от артефактов. Полученная таким образом выборка поступает в подсистему 2, где хранится и при необходимости извлекается с частотой (имеется в виду частота дискретизации), которая необходима для дальнейших операций. В принципе, данные, содержащиеся в указанной выборке, уже могут сравниваться с эталонными, однако для корректного сравнения функций их следует представлять в едином масштабе как временном, так и амплитудном. Для этих целей в систему дополнительно введены две подсистемы масштабирования во времени (5 и 6) и две подсистемы нормирования (7 и 8). Первые служат для сжатия или растяжения во времени сравниваемых процессов, т.е. для уравнивания скоростей их протекания. Что же касается нормирования функций, то для реализации этой операции достаточно обеспечить вычисление отношений вида

где (tx) - значение функции, выбранное за опорное в точке tx, например среднее;

н(t) - в данном случае нормированная функция на выходе подсистемы 7.

Один из вариантов реализации подсистемы нормирования показан на фиг.2. Из схемы легко увидеть, что основу подсистемы действительно составляет блок 11 деления, на

выходе которого и формируется нормированная функция н(t). Найденное опорное значение предварительно помещают в блок 10, который физически является блоком памяти с ограниченным объемом, например, регистром.

Эталонные данные хранятся в банке 3 априорных данных, извлечением которых управляет подсистема 4 выбора класса процессов, которая, по сути, представляет собой узел управления адресным пространством памяти 3, в которой информация о хранимых процессах сгруппирована по областям в зависимости от наличия общих признаков. Отметим, что подсистема 4 используется при выборе адресов памяти как во время записи, так и во время считывания информации. В простейшем случае подсистема 4 может представлять собой управляемый задатчик двоичных кодов.

После выбора эталонного процесса 0(t) и прохождения этапов масштабирования и нормирования имеем величину (t). Непосредственно сравнение функций н(t) и (t) происходит в подсистеме 9, в которой вычисляют функционал , принятый за меру уклонения и отвечающий следующим минимальным требованиям.

причем только при н(t)= (t).

Вышеприведенный функционал может быть представлен в различных видах, выражаемых различными математическими зависимостями. При этом будут получены и различные критерии сравнения. Приведем некоторые из них, лежащие в основе зависимых пунктов формулы полезной модели.

Наиболее простым для реализации и понимания является критерий равномерного сравнения, согласно которому определяется максимум модуля разности сравниваемых функций (п.2 формулы)

Достаточно полезным является интегральный критерий, к которому несложно перейти от вышеприведенного и который записывается в следующем виде (п.3 формулы)

Интегрирование следует производить в пределах времени действия сравниваемых процессов. Указанный критерий можно привести и к более удобному для оценки и понимания виду, если перейти к некоторой усредненной величине (п.4 формулы)

В данном случае 1ср является усредненным показателем уклонения сравниваемых функций. В случае, если операция выделения модуля по каким-либо причинам окажется нереализуемой, можно перейти к критерию среднеквадратического сравнения (п.5 формулы)

Последний критерий носит название корреляционного и предполагает вычисление корреляционного интеграла вида

В случае с корреляционным критерием в отличие от вышеприведенных критериев величина R не равна нулю при равенстве сравниваемых функций, а, напротив, возрастает с увеличением степени подобия сравниваемых функций. Для практических расчетов удобно применять коэффициент подобия (п.6 формулы)

Коэффициент подобия LК лежит в пределах 0LК1. Ситуации максимальной близости сравниваемых функций соответствует критерий LК=1. При L К=0 корреляции нет, следовательно, исследуемый процесс не похож на эталонную функцию.

Отметим, что алгоритм функционирования подсистемы 9 сравнения полностью определяется вышеприведенными критериями, их выражением в математической форме. В качестве примера на фиг.3 показана конкретная функциональная схема подсистемы 9 в предположении, что сравнение происходит путем вычисления величины 1ср.

1. Система сравнительного анализа социально-экономических процессов, отличающаяся тем, что включает в себя подсистему выделения репрезентативной части исследуемого процесса, подсистему хранения выборки исследуемого процесса, подсистему масштабирования во времени исследуемого процесса, подсистему нормирования исследуемого процесса, банк априорных данных, подсистему выбора класса процессов, подсистему масштабирования во времени эталонного процесса, подсистему нормирования эталонного процесса и подсистему сравнения исследуемого и эталонного процессов, подсистема выделения репрезентативной части предназначена для получения исходных данных и формирования выборки содержащей информацию о характерных свойствах исследуемого процесса, выход подсистемы выделения репрезентативной части соединен со входом подсистемы хранения выборки исследуемого процесса, выход которой соединен со входом подсистемы масштабирования во времени исследуемого процесса, выход которой соединен со входом подсистемы нормирования исследуемого процесса, управляющий вход банка априорных данных соединен с выходом подсистемы выбора класса процессов, выход банка априорных данных соединен со входом подсистемы масштабирования во времени эталонного процесса, выход которой соединен со входом подсистемы нормирования эталонного процесса, выход которой соединен с первым входом подсистемы сравнения, второй вход которой соединен с выходом подсистемы нормирования исследуемого процесса.

2. Система по п.1, отличающаяся тем, что подсистема сравнения исследуемого и эталонного процессов выполнена на основе вычислителя максимальной величины абсолютного уклонения сравниваемых величин.

3. Система по п.1, отличающаяся тем, что подсистема сравнения исследуемого и эталонного процессов выполнена на основе вычислителя интеграла от модуля разности сравниваемых величин.

4. Система по п.1, отличающаяся тем, что подсистема сравнения исследуемого и эталонного процессов выполнена на основе вычислителя среднего значения модуля разности сравниваемых величин.

5. Система по п.1, отличающаяся тем, что подсистема сравнения исследуемого и эталонного процессов выполнена на основе вычислителя среднеквадратического значения разности сравниваемых величин.

6. Система по п.1, отличающаяся тем, что подсистема сравнения исследуемого и эталонного процессов выполнена на основе вычислителя корреляционного интеграла.



 

Наверх